emphis Kappa Kappa Gamma Alumnae Association threw its sixth annual Literacy is Key: A Book and Author Event at the Holiday Inn University of Memphis. Featuring acclaimed authors, a luncheon and a VIP author meet-andgreet, this event benefited First Book, a nonprofit organization who works to provide children from low-income families with their first new books. Authors included: Dorothea Benton Frank, author of “All Summer Long” and “All the Single Ladies”; Laura Lane McNeal, author of “Dollbaby”; and local Mark Greaney, author of “The Gray Man” series and co-author for Hillery Efkeman and Dorothea Benton Frank several Tom Clancy titles such as “Locked On.” Before lunch, book lovers purchased select titles by the featured authors. VIP guests enjoyed mimosas as they mingled with the authors. During lunch, authors spoke about their recent works. With a donation of $20, attendees had the chance to receive a previously loved prizewinning paperback that contained gifts certificates for everything from jewelry to art to clothing. Later, authors signed books and chatted with the crowd.
